My 19wk old DS has started sleeping on his side - I put him down to sleep on his back but he immediately rolls onto his side. I was just wondering if this is something I should be worried about? I've tried gently rolling him onto his back but he just does the same thing again! Thanks.

OP posts:
PossetFeatures · 01/09/2011 19:22

Oooh my DS (nearly 7 months) has recently started doing this, and I was surprised and a bit worried at first, but was told that when they start doing this and can move around then it's fine and not considered risky! Incidently since he's started doing this we've 5 nights out of 7 sleeping through the night which he NEVER did before- I wonder if now he can move around and get into a comfy position he sleeps better, a bit like adults I guess...

MagnumIcecreamAddict · 01/09/2011 22:09

Don't worry. Funny isn't it Posset - mine only started sleeping through once he could get himself turned onto his side and tummy.

OP - maybe make sure he has plenty of tummytime during the day so he strengthens his neck/back muscles. If you are confident he can lift his head and turn it from side to side then I really wouldn't worry.
